Abahani, Mohun Bagan lock horns today


Published : 18 Apr 2022 09:52 PM

The full focus of the football fans of Bangladesh and West Bengal will be on Salt lake Stadium, Kolkata when they will have euphoric occasions with the Indian giants ATK Mohun Bagan and the Dhaka giants Abahani Limited will play their vital encounter of the AFC Cup playoff match today.

The match will kick off at 7 pm (IST) with both the traditional giants of the neighboring country will combat to make their room in the group stage.  

If the stipulate 90 minutes and the extra 30 minutes game will be end on a draw then the result will be decided by tie breaker and the winners will advance to the next round to join with the Chennaiyan FC, Maziya Sports and Recreation Club, Banshundhara Kings.

In their previous head to head meetings ATK Mohun Bagan are ahead of the Abahani Limited when in the same AFC Cup competition in 2017, the Kolkata Titan won the match by 3-1 at Salt Lake Stadium and in the returned leg, at the Bangbandhu Stadium the match was one all draw.

It will be a tough challenge for the both the host Mohun Bagan and the visitors Abahani Limited, the host will have some home advantage, as 60,000 capacity arena that takes its name and shape from the traditional tents used by passionate supporters of the Kolkata City.

Mohun Bagan bidding to qualify in the Playoff phase defeated Sri Lankan team Blue Star by 5-0 while Abahani got walkover against their Maldives opponents Valencia withdrew their name.

Abahani Limited went Kolkata with a setback when their Brazilian forward Dorielton Gomes is uncertain, as he has an injury but it would be a big plus point if the Brazilian will come round and would fit for the match.

Satiyajit Das Rupu, when talking to the Bangladesh Post from Kolkata after their pre-match press conference on Monday said that they are ready to take on the Mohun Bagan.

Rupu, said, “It’s very usual that as a host Mohun Bagan will have a big advantage, their home ground, home crowd. But I hope it will be very competitive match and we will win the match.”

Rupu replying to a query said that essentially they have idea about the opponents and they have chalked out plans to face on them – “Yes, we noticed about some of their danger men and we have plan to deal with them but players will have to execute in the field. They have also plan against us.”

“There is no scope to make any mistake, otherwise will have to face tough time.”

Rupu also said, “They are not under pressure, players will play their usual game, all are professional players, they are ready to take the challenge.”

About Dorielton’s availability for today’s match, Rupu, said, “He still uncertain but will try, if possible then will play.”  

Bangladesh team’s captain Nabib Newaz Jibon, also expressed his expectation to win the match when he said in the press meet, “Our target to win the match and will try our best.”

But Abahani, included the Bosnia Herzegovina forward Nedo Turkovic on loan from Swadhinota Krira Sangha.

Meanwhile, the captain of the ATK Mohun Bagan Pritam Kotal is highly expected and confident about their win the match against Abahani when he expressed his belief in pre-match press conference on Monday.

Pritam when replying to a query to the media, with due respect to the opponents (Abahani) took the match as a final and said, “It will be another final match for us. I hope we will win tomorrow.         

Abahani is strong team, national team competition and club football is different ball game. We will play our football. It will be an exciting match tomorrow, we are ready to take on the challenge.”

Pritam also honored Bangladesh football when he said, “Actually it’s always tough match against Bangladesh whether it is national team or club competition.”
